Adoption Law Attorneys in Jama Masjid - Delhi

Top Adoption Law Attorneys Businesses

Midland Tools

No. 204, Meena Bazar, Jama Masjid, Near Chawri Bazar, Near Chawri Metro Station, Near Chandni Chowk Metro Station

Delhi- 110006, Delhi (India)